Türkü isn't a genre you dip into. It's a lineage. Radyo 7 Türkü treats it that way, programming the long Anatolian arc from Aşık Veysel's lone saz recordings through Neşet Ertaş's bozlak rasp and on to Selda Bağcan's electrified '70s experiments. The core of the schedule is voice and bağlama, sometimes just those two things. Uzun hava passages stretch out for minutes, all breath and ornament, and the station resists the urge to cut them short. Good. That's the point. Where it stumbles is variety.
